Exegesis

The verse is a single narrative sentence built with two sequential wayyiqtol verbs, vayyashev {וַיָּשֶׁב | wayyāšeb} and vayyiten {וַיִּתֵּן | wayyittēn}, each introduced by the vav consecutive to signal successive actions.

The first clause, vayyashev et sar hamashqim ʿal mashqehu {וַיָּשֶׁב אֶת־שַׂר הַמַּשְׁקִים עַל־מַשְׁקֵהוּ}, uses the Hiphil to express causative restoration of the official to his former position. The prepositional phrase ʿal mashqehu functions as a marker of reinstatement “to” his domain of service.

In contextGenesis 40:21

And he restored the chief of the cupbearers to his cupbearing, and he placed the cup upon Pharaoh’s hand .
